• [C-5-12] Malfunction code 51 (Front wheel does not recover from the locking tendency
even though the signal is continuously transmitted from the ECU (ABS) to release the
hydraulic pressure [when the battery voltage is low].)
Check the following:
1) Rotation of the front wheel
Refer to "[C-5-10] Malfunction code 41".
2) Brake master cylinder and brake caliper
Refer to "[C-5-10] Malfunction code 41".
3) Brake fluid
Refer to "[C-5-10] Malfunction code 41".
4) Brake hose lines
Refer to "[C-5-10] Malfunction code 41".
5) Hydraulic unit solenoid coupler terminals
Refer to "[C-5-10] Malfunction code 41".
6) Hydraulic unit
Refer to "[C-5-10] Malfunction code 41".
7) Battery voltage
Measure the battery voltage.
• [C-5-13] Malfunction code 52 (Rear wheel does not recover from the locking tendency even
though the signal is continuously transmitted from the ECU (ABS) to release the hydraulic
pressure [when the battery voltage is low].)
Check the following:
1) Rotation of the rear wheel
Refer to "[C-5-11] Malfunction code 42".
2) Brake master cylinder and brake caliper
Refer to "[C-5-11] Malfunction code 42".
3) Brake fluid
Refer to "[C-5-11] Malfunction code 42".
4) Brake hose lines
Refer to "[C-5-11] Malfunction code 42".
5) Hydraulic unit solenoid coupler terminals
Refer to "[C-5-11] Malfunction code 42".
6) Hydraulic unit
Refer to "[C-5-11] Malfunction code 42".
7) Battery voltage
Measure the battery voltage.
